Heating Efficiency
The DREO Space Heater features a robust 1500W PTC ceramic heating system, enabling it to deliver powerful heat rapidly within seconds, making it suitable for larger rooms or prolonged use. In contrast, the Gaiatop Mini Space Heater operates at a lower 500W, which is efficient for quick heating but may be better suited for smaller areas or as a supplementary heater. This difference in heating capacity highlights the DREO's advantage for those needing more significant heating power quickly.

Safety Features
Safety is a critical consideration for space heaters, and both models come equipped with essential safety features. The DREO Space Heater includes a tilt-detection sensor for improved tip-over protection, along with overheat protection and flame retardant materials. Meanwhile, the Gaiatop Mini Space Heater also offers overheating protection and a 45° tip-over safety mechanism. While both heaters prioritize user safety, the DREO’s additional features may provide extra peace of mind for families or those using the heater for extended periods.

Versatility and Features
The DREO Space Heater offers a range of features that enhance its versatility, including multiple heating modes (Power heat, ECO, and Fan Only), a remote control, and a 12-hour timer. This array of options allows users to customize their heating experience based on their needs. In contrast, the Gaiatop Mini Space Heater has a more straightforward design with fewer features, focusing primarily on efficient heating. For users who appreciate advanced functionality, the DREO may be the better choice.
